Early automobiles - Georges Boillot
Photo shows Georges Louis Frederic Boillot (1884-1916), a French Grand Prix motor racing driver sitting in a Peugot EX3, possibly ca. June 1914 when he set a new speed record at the Indianapolis 500. (Source: F... More
Georges Fabre & M. Chambenoist - Glass negative photogrpah. Public dom...
Photograph shows Georges Fabre, left, with pilot Chambenoist, in an airplane which has his bomb-dropping device, the Fabre apparatus. (Source: Flickr Commons project, 2012 and Illustrated War News, 1915)

Young Kate Frommert enjoys all the Easter trimmings at the Three Georg...
Founded in 1917 by George Coudopolos, George Sparr, and George Pappas, Three Georges Candy was an immediate hit. By 1922, the company expanded into the Dauphin Street location. Title, date, subject note, and ke... More
